Ohm Pawat postpones fan meeting in Manila

Ohm Pawat postpones fan meeting in Manila

Clipboard

Thai superstar Ohm Pawat’s fan meeting in the Philippines has been postponed until further notice. This was announced by local concert promoter Wilbros Live on their social media account earlier this week.

Ohm’s first fan meeting in the country was supposed to happen on January 27, 6 p.m. at the Samsung Hall in SM Aura Premier in Taguig City.

“Please be informed that OHM PAWAT’s 1st Fan Meeting in Manila will be postponed until further notice. Fans who have purchased tickets will receive a refund from SM Tickets,” Wilbros Live said in the statement.

“Fans can repurchase tickets to the new date once we announce the new date and new ticket selling date. We sincerely apologize for the inconvenience and we thank you for your support to Ohm Pawat,” the statement added.

Both Wilbros Live and Ohm’s management failed to disclose the reason his fan meeting in Manila was postponed.

Meanwhile, fans of the Thai actor expressed their disappointment as they have been looking forward to seeing him in a solo fan meeting. They shared their sentiments in the comment section of the announcement.

“I've been looking forward to it for so long, it's so sad,” a fan shared.

“I know this is going to happen and as long as it's not canceled, it's okay to postpone the event. But please improve the fan benefits and hear us out,” another fan added.

Ohm previously held a fan meeting in the country with his co-star and on screen partner, Nanong Korapat last January 21, 2023 which was attended by their fans.

Ohm rose to popularity by starring in several boys’ love series such as He’s Coming to Me, Make It Right, and Bad Buddy.
